服务器日志是记录服务器运行状态、操作记录和错误信息的重要文件,对于监控服务器运行情况和排查问题具有重要意义,当服务器日志出现问题时,重启日志服务是一个常见的解决方法,以下是如何重启服务器日志的详细步骤和注意事项。

停止日志服务
在重启日志服务之前,首先需要停止当前正在运行的日志服务,以下是几种常见操作系统的停止日志服务方法:
Windows系统
- 打开“服务”管理器:按下
Win + R,输入services.msc,然后按回车。 - 找到“Windows Event Log”服务,右键点击选择“停止”。
Linux系统
- 使用
systemctl命令停止日志服务(以RHEL/CentOS为例):systemctl stop rsyslog
或者使用
service命令:service rsyslog stop
重启日志服务
停止日志服务后,接下来需要重启日志服务,以下是重启日志服务的方法:
Windows系统
- 在“服务”管理器中,找到“Windows Event Log”服务。
- 右键点击选择“重启”。
Linux系统
- 使用
systemctl命令重启日志服务:systemctl restart rsyslog
或者使用
service命令:service rsyslog restart
验证日志服务状态
重启日志服务后,需要验证日志服务是否正常运行,以下是验证方法:

Windows系统
- 在“服务”管理器中,找到“Windows Event Log”服务。
- 查看服务状态是否为“正在运行”。
Linux系统
- 使用
systemctl命令查看日志服务状态:systemctl status rsyslog
或者使用
service命令:service rsyslog status
检查日志文件
重启日志服务后,可以检查日志文件是否正常生成,以下是一些检查日志文件的方法:
- 使用
tail命令查看最新日志:tail f /var/log/syslog
- 使用
less或cat命令查看日志文件内容:less /var/log/syslog
经验案例:酷盾日志服务重启
在酷盾的云产品中,我们经常遇到客户需要重启日志服务的情况,以下是一个经验案例:
案例描述:某企业使用酷盾日志服务,由于系统升级导致日志服务异常,需要重启日志服务。
解决方案:通过以下步骤成功重启日志服务:

- 停止日志服务:
systemctl stop rsyslog - 重启日志服务:
systemctl restart rsyslog - 验证日志服务状态:
systemctl status rsyslog - 检查日志文件:
tail f /var/log/syslog
通过以上步骤,成功重启了日志服务,恢复了日志的正常记录。
FAQs
Q1:为什么需要重启日志服务?
A1:重启日志服务可以解决日志服务异常、日志文件损坏等问题,确保日志记录的准确性和完整性。
Q2:重启日志服务后,日志会丢失吗?
A2:一般情况下,重启日志服务不会导致日志丢失,但如果日志服务停止时间过长,可能会丢失部分日志数据,建议在重启前备份重要日志文件。
文献权威来源
《Linux系统管理员手册》、《Windows系统管理指南》、《系统日志管理与应用》等。
原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/400472.html